“The rule and life of the Secular Franciscan is this: to observe the gospel of our Lord Jesus Christ by following the example of Saint Francis of Assisi, who made Christ the inspiration and the center of his life with God and people.”
Rule of the Secular Franciscan Order, 4
Who are the Secular Franciscans?
The Order of Franciscans Secular (O.F.S.) is a worldwide community of Catholic men and women who seek to pattern their lives after Christ in the spirit of St. Francis of Assisi. Our purpose is to bring the Gospel to life where we live and where we work.
The Secular Franciscans were founded by St. Francis of Assisi about 800 years ago. Over four million Secular Franciscans worldwide follow the Rule of the Secular Franciscan Order, living and working in various circumstances of life to build a more fraternal and evangelical world, promoting justice, peace, fidelity, and respect for life, in service of the the human community (Rule of the Secular Franciscan Order, 14-19).
The St. Cloud Fraternity of Secular Franciscans was founded in 1923, and will celebrate its 100th anniversary of establishment in 2023. Our fraternity has over 20 members, living and working in various ways in their communities, workplaces, and parishes. Our fraternity meets on the third Sunday of every month at St. John Cantius Church in St. Cloud (Minnesota). We would love to tell you more about our fraternity!
